Hi Jim- > Here's another possible bug. > > This bundle should create loop of KMTX radar reflectivity over a > terrain shade background map. I love these loops and am quickly > learning that the radar manipulation is probably the strongest aspect of > IDV. Glad to hear it. > When I generate manually, theres no problem. After saving the > bundle, I reload, but it puts the terrain on top. Further, when I move > the radar to the top, it won't display the low dBZ's as transparent. The problem is that the dislay does not get added to the window until it has data. Transparency is dependent on the order in which displays are added (last one will be transparent). In your case, it sounds like the radar gets added before the background, so transparency no longer works. This was fixed in 1.3b2 for Level III radar and satellite imagery by adding in dummy data immediately and not waiting for the server. We'll look at doing this for all displays. Also, in 1.3b2, you can use the View->To Front menu option to bring the radar to the front (which removes and re-adds the display), thereby enabling transparency.
